MUX36S16IPW Description
The MUX36S16IPW is a high-performance 16:1 multiplexer/demultiplexer from Texas Instruments, designed to offer exceptional signal integrity and reliability in a compact 28-TSSOP package. This device is ideal for applications requiring low on-state resistance and minimal signal distortion. The MUX36S16IPW supports a wide supply voltage range, from ±5V to ±18V for dual supplies and 10V to 36V for single supplies, making it suitable for a variety of power configurations. Its low leakage current of 40pA ensures minimal power consumption and high efficiency, even in low-power applications.
MUX36S16IPW Features
- Low On-State Resistance: The MUX36S16IPW boasts a maximum on-state resistance of 170Ω, ensuring minimal signal attenuation and high signal integrity.
- Channel-to-Channel Matching: With a typical channel-to-channel matching of 6Ω, this multiplexer ensures consistent performance across all channels, critical for applications requiring precise signal routing.
- Low Channel Capacitance: The device features low off-state channel capacitance (CS(off) = 2.1pF, CD(off) = 11.1pF), which minimizes signal interference and improves overall system performance.
- Fast Switching Times: The MUX36S16IPW offers fast turn-on and turn-off times of 136ns and 78ns, respectively, enabling rapid signal switching and efficient data processing.
- Charge Injection: Minimal charge injection of 0.31pC ensures that signal integrity is maintained during switching, reducing transient effects and improving overall system performance.
- Compliance and Reliability: The MUX36S16IPW is REACH unaffected and RoHS3 compliant, ensuring environmental and regulatory compliance. Additionally, it has a moisture sensitivity level (MSL) of 3, suitable for surface-mount assembly processes.
MUX36S16IPW Applications
The MUX36S16IPW is well-suited for a variety of applications where high performance and reliability are essential. Some specific use cases include:
- Data Acquisition Systems: The low on-state resistance and fast switching times make it ideal for routing signals in data acquisition systems, ensuring accurate and efficient data capture.
- Telecommunications: In telecom applications, the MUX36S16IPW can be used for signal switching in base stations and other communication infrastructure, providing reliable and low-distortion signal routing.
- Industrial Control Systems: The wide supply voltage range and robust performance characteristics make it suitable for industrial applications where reliability and durability are paramount.
- Medical Equipment: The device's compliance with environmental and regulatory standards makes it suitable for use in medical equipment, where precision and reliability are critical.
